linux常見命令:
文件相關
創建和刪除
touch 創建一個普通文件
mkdir 創建一個目錄文件
ln 創建一個鏈接文件
rm 刪除一個文件或目錄
查看和搜索
echo 將命令後面的內容,輸出到當前屏幕
cat 查看文件內容
find 搜索文件內容
grep 過濾關鍵字內容
man 查看命令幫助信息
zcat 查看壓縮包文件內容
傳輸和壓縮
scp 跨主機遠程傳輸文件
cp 拷貝文件
mv 移動文件或者文件改名
wget 下載文件
tar 文件的壓縮和解壓縮
unzip 解壓文件
用戶相關
useradd 創建用戶
passwd 給用戶創建密碼或更改密碼
su - 切換用戶
權限相關
chmod 更改文件的操作權限
chown 更改文件的用戶屬性
網絡相關
ifconfig 查看當前系統的網卡信息
ping 測試主機間網絡是否連通
free 查看當前主機的內存信息
netstat 查看當前系統開啓的端口信息
lsof 查看進程相關信息
計算相關
$((算數表達式))
let 算數表達式
常見快捷鍵:
Ctrl + l 清屏
其他命令
sed 行編輯工具
awk 文檔編輯工具
vim知識點
三種模式:
未編輯模式、編輯模式、命令行模式
模式切換:
進入編輯模式:
a 當行
o 光標所在行的下一行
O 光標所在行的上一行
退出編輯模式:
Esc
wq! 注意點:用sudo改動只讀文件時,可用這個命令退出
進入命令行模式:
:
編輯
yy 複製
p 粘貼
dd 剪切或刪除
保存
wq 保存
搜索
G 跳轉到當前文檔末尾行的首字符
gg 跳轉到當前文檔首行的首字符
^ 跳轉到當前文檔光標所在行的首字符
$ 跳轉到當前文檔光標所在行的末尾字符
/關鍵字 搜索關鍵字
linux 常見的路徑
./ 當前目錄
../ 當前位置的上一級目錄
linux常見符號
> 以覆蓋的方式給文件增加內容
>> 以追加的方式給文件末尾行的下一行增加內容
| 將左側內容,傳遞給右側使用
如有侵權,請聯繫我!!!